About The Position

The Intermediate Care Unit (IMC) / Progressive Care Unit (PCU) provides specialized care for patients who require a higher level of monitoring and intervention than a medical-surgical floor but do not meet criteria for intensive care. Patients in this unit often present with complex cardiac, respiratory, and post-surgical conditions requiring continuous telemetry monitoring, frequent nursing assessments and interventions, advanced medication management and titration, and rapid response readiness. This unit serves as a critical step-down environment designed to stabilize patients and support recovery while maintaining close observation.
